You have, on the bottom the number of cars and on the left the corresponding probability.
The probability of having 4 cars is 0.05; the probability of having 5 cars is 0.05 again.
Therefore, the probability of having more than 3 cars is P(4) + P(5) = 0.10 which corresponds to 10%.
The correct answer is 0.10
